San Antonio is under an Excessive Heat Warning today, with temperatures expected to reach the upper-90s and heat index values potentially topping 110°. The humidity will be especially thick, making the ‘feels like’ temperature even higher.
Friday and Saturday Forecast
On Friday, a few storms may move into the area from the northwest, although they are expected to stay north of San Antonio. Temperatures will cool slightly due to added cloud cover, but it will still be hot and humid, with heat index values possibly exceeding 100°. Outflow boundaries from storms to the north may trigger more storms Friday evening and night.
Into Saturday, rain chances continue, with the distribution of storms depending on outflow boundaries. There’s a 50% chance of rain through Saturday afternoon, with some areas potentially seeing heavy rainfall. Quieter weather is expected on Sunday for Father’s Day.
